I play guitar, piano, electric bass and keyboards well enough to write my own songs. I know some music theory. I can write my own charts Nashville Number System style.

I like doing remixes: filter house, funky R&B, old-school soul-type stuff. But I also like doing some textural guitar work kinda like Richard Werbowenko at ASCHE AND SPENCER does. I like making my guitar sound like a keyboard synth with a lot of effects.

I listen to a lot of classical music...especially Rimsky-Korsakov. And I listen to a lot of film soundtracks...for harmony ideas. I like big pretty chords and progressions. If I like a piece of music...I will learn bits and pieces of the tune just enough to learn the tune. Then, I take the idea...and make it my own. I jam on it. If I like what I hear. I write it down in my notebook.
